- The distance between Bermuda, Bermuda and Ye, Myanmar is approximately 14,404 km or 8,951 mi.
- To reach Bermuda in this distance one would set out from Ye bearing 340.8°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Bermuda bearing 202° or SSW .
- Bermuda has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Ye has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- The annual mean temperature is 3.9 °C (7.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 5.8 °C (10.4°F) more in Bermuda.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 3119 mm (122.8 in) less which is equivalent to 3119 l/m² (76.55 US gal/ft²) or 31,190,000 l/ha (3,334,418 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 14.1° lower in Bermuda than in Ye.
